/*
 * Generate definitions needed by assembly language modules.
 * This code generates raw asm output which is post-processed
 * to extract and format the required data.
 */

#include <xen/config.h>
#include <xen/sched.h>
#include <asm/processor.h>
#include <asm/ptrace.h>
#include <asm/mca.h>
#include <public/xen.h>
#include <asm/tlb.h>
#include <asm/regs.h>
#include <asm/xenmca.h>

#define task_struct vcpu

#define DEFINE(sym, val) \
        asm volatile("\n->" #sym " (%0) " #val : : "i" (val))

#define BLANK() asm volatile("\n->" : : )

#define OFFSET(_sym, _str, _mem) \
    DEFINE(_sym, offsetof(_str, _mem));

void foo(void)
{
	DEFINE(IA64_TASK_SIZE, sizeof (struct task_struct));
	DEFINE(IA64_THREAD_INFO_SIZE, sizeof (struct thread_info));
	DEFINE(IA64_PT_REGS_SIZE, sizeof (struct pt_regs));
	DEFINE(IA64_SWITCH_STACK_SIZE, sizeof (struct switch_stack));
	DEFINE(IA64_CPU_SIZE, sizeof (struct cpuinfo_ia64));
	DEFINE(UNW_FRAME_INFO_SIZE, sizeof (struct unw_frame_info));
	DEFINE(MAPPED_REGS_T_SIZE, sizeof (mapped_regs_t));

	BLANK();
